Web24 jan. 2024 · The greatest differences between a male guinea fowl and a female guinea fowl include their morphology and the sounds they make. The male guinea fowl is known for having a larger wattle, a larger casque, and more cupping in the wattle structure, and they also make monosyllable calls.

WebMale guinea pigs become sexually active within 3 weeks of birth, whereas it may take the female guinea pig about 4 weeks. Hence, it is important to separate male guinea pigs from their mothers, sisters, and other female guinea pigs when they are 4 weeks old unless you want unwanted litters of these cavies in your home. Web22 mrt. 2024 · A female guinea pig will have a genital area that resembles a “Y” shape while males have more of an “i” shape. The dot on the “i” is the penis, and you can confirm your guinea pig is male by applying slight pressure above the genitals. Web4 jul. 2024 · The male guinea fowl is known for having a larger wattle, a larger casque, and more cupping in the wattle structure, and they also make monosyllable calls. Female guinea fowls have smaller wattles and crest, and are known for making a two-syllable sound that differentiates them from males.
